Item No: 06B <br />Meeting Date: June 22, 2015 <br />Type of Business: SO <br />City Administrator Review: _____ <br />City of Mounds View Staff Report <br />To: Honorable Mayor and City Council <br />From: Brian Erickson, P.E., Director of Public Works/City <br />Engineer <br />Item Title/Subject: Annual Storm Water Public Information Meeting <br /> <br />Introduction: <br />As part of the City of Mounds View’s Municipal Separate Storm Sewer System (MS4), there is a <br />requirement for an annual public information meeting. <br /> <br />Discussion: <br />The City of Mounds View as a MS4 permitee by the Minnesota Pollution Control Agency (MPCA) <br />is charged with meeting a number of requirements. One of those requirements is an annual <br />Storm Water Public Information Meeting. As part of this meeting Public Works will present an <br />update of the actions completed for 2014 as well as initiatives for the future. <br /> <br />Respectfully submitted, <br /> <br /> <br /> <br />_______________________ <br />Brian Erickson <br />Director of Public Works/City Engineer
